What are the properties of gases used in pneumatics?

Gases used in pneumatics should be non-toxic, non-flammable, and environmentally friendly. They should also have low moisture content to prevent corrosion and be easily compressible to allow for energy-efficient operation of pneumatic systems. Additionally, gases used in pneumatics should have consistent properties to ensure reliable performance in various temperature and pressure conditions.


What is throttling range in pneumatics?

Throttling range in pneumatics refers to the operational limits within which a pneumatic system can control the flow of air to achieve desired performance. It is typically defined by the minimum and maximum flow rates that can be adjusted by throttling devices, such as valves or flow restrictors. This range is crucial for ensuring optimal system efficiency and responsiveness in various applications, such as automation and control processes. Properly managing the throttling range helps maintain pressure stability and reduces energy consumption.
